Título:
Assimilation of C-band radar data using the SCALE-LETKF system: A supercell case study during the RELAMPAGO field campaign
Autor/es:
PAULA SOLEDAD MALDONADO; JUAN RUIZ; CELESTE SAULO; TAKUMI HONDA; TAKEMASA MIYOSHI
Reunión:
Workshop; 6th Workshop on Mesoscale Modeling; 2023
Resumen:
Southern South America is frequently affected by strong convection that producesnegative impacts on the population and their activities. Forecasting high-impact weatherevents associated with deep, moist convection is an open challenge due to the limitedpredictability and observability of mesoscale circulations. In recent years, significantadvances have been made in using convective-scale numerical weather prediction anddata assimilation systems to produce very short-range forecasts (on the scale ofminutes) of high-impact weather events (see, for example, Yano et al. 2018). However,only few studies have focused on the application of high-resolution data assimilationsystems in South America (e.g., Vendrasco et al. 2020). Recently, the radar network inArgentina has been significantly expanded, creating new opportunities for theimprovement of very short-range forecasts of high-impact weather events. In this work,we investigate the implementation of an ensemble-based data assimilation system basedon the Local Ensemble Transform Kalman filter (LETKF) coupled with the ScalableComputing for Advanced Library and Environment (SCALE) regional model (Lien etal. 2017) and its performance in a case of a supercell thunderstorm that occurred incentral Argentina during the RELAMPAGO field campaign (Nesbitt et al. 2021).
